为什么学校让学编程不让学生

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学校让学生学习编程的原因有很多。首先,编程是一种重要的技能,是现代社会中不可或缺的一部分。随着科技的迅猛发展,编程技能已经成为许多行业的必备技能。学校希望培养学生的综合素质,包括科学技术能力,因此编程成为学校教育的一部分。

    其次,学习编程可以培养学生的创造力和解决问题的能力。编程涉及到逻辑思维、分析能力和解决问题的能力。通过编程的学习,学生可以锻炼自己的思维方式和解决问题的能力,培养他们的创造力和创新精神。

    另外,学习编程也可以培养学生的团队合作能力和沟通能力。在编程过程中,学生需要与他人合作,共同解决问题。通过与他人的合作,学生可以学会有效的沟通和合作,提高团队合作能力。

    此外,学习编程还可以提高学生的思维能力和逻辑思维能力。编程需要学生进行逻辑思考和思维训练,培养他们的思维能力和逻辑思维能力,提高他们的学习能力和解决问题的能力。

    最后,学校让学生学习编程还有一个重要原因是为了培养学生的创业精神。编程技能可以让学生创造自己的软件和应用程序,培养学生的创业意识和创新能力,为他们将来的职业发展打下基础。

    综上所述,学校让学生学习编程的原因包括培养综合素质、提高创造力和解决问题的能力、培养团队合作能力和沟通能力、提高思维能力和逻辑思维能力,以及培养创业精神。通过学习编程,学生可以获得更多的机会和竞争优势,为他们的未来发展打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学校让学生学习编程的原因有以下几点:

    1. 适应未来就业需求:随着科技的发展,编程技能在各个行业中的需求越来越大。学校意识到这一点,决定让学生学习编程,以帮助他们适应未来就业市场的需求。

    2. 培养创新思维:编程是一门创造性的学科,通过学习编程,学生可以培养创新思维和解决问题的能力。这些能力对于学生未来的职业发展非常重要。

    3. 提高学生的逻辑思维能力:编程需要学生进行逻辑思考和分析问题的能力。通过编程学习,学生可以提高自己的逻辑思维能力,这对于他们的学习和生活都有积极的影响。

    4. 培养团队合作能力:在编程过程中,学生通常需要与其他学生合作完成项目。这样可以培养学生的团队合作能力和沟通能力,提高他们与他人合作的能力。

    5. 增强学生的问题解决能力:编程过程中经常会遇到各种问题,学生需要通过分析和解决问题来完成任务。这样可以帮助学生培养问题解决能力和自主学习能力,提高他们的学习能力和自信心。

    总之,学校让学生学习编程的目的是为了帮助他们适应未来的就业市场需求,培养创新思维和解决问题的能力,提高逻辑思维能力,培养团队合作能力,并增强学生的问题解决能力。这些能力对学生的未来发展非常重要。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学校推动学生学习编程的原因是为了培养学生的计算思维能力、创造力和解决问题的能力。学生学习编程可以帮助他们提高逻辑思维、分析问题和解决问题的能力,培养他们的创造力和创新精神,以及培养他们在数字化时代所需的技能。

    然而,并不是所有的学校都鼓励学生学习编程的原因有以下几个方面:

    1. 缺乏专业老师和教育资源:学校可能没有足够的编程教师和教育资源来教授学生编程知识。编程是一门专业性较强的学科,需要有专业的教师来指导学生学习。如果学校没有足够的教师和教育资源,就很难开设编程课程。

    2. 教学压力和时间限制:学校的教学计划通常是按照一定的课程安排和学习进度进行的,学校可能觉得学生已经有了足够的学习负担,没有时间和精力来学习编程。教师需要按照教学计划来完成教学任务,可能没有额外的时间来教授编程知识。

    3. 学生兴趣和能力的不同:学生的兴趣和能力各不相同,学校可能认为并不是所有的学生都对编程感兴趣或具备学习编程的能力。学校可能更加注重学生的综合素质和基础学科的学习,而不是特别强调编程技能。

    然而,随着社会的发展和科技的进步,编程已经成为一项重要的技能,越来越多的学校开始意识到学生学习编程的重要性,并逐渐将其纳入课程中。为了推动学生学习编程,学校可以采取以下措施:

    1. 提供专业的编程教师和教育资源:学校可以招聘专业的编程教师或与外部机构合作,提供优质的编程教育资源和课程。

    2. 调整教学计划和时间安排:学校可以适当调整教学计划和时间安排,为学生提供学习编程的时间和空间。

    3. 提供多样化的学习方式:学校可以提供多种学习方式,如课堂教学、在线学习平台、编程俱乐部等,以满足学生的不同学习需求和兴趣。

    4. 增加编程课程的实践性:学校可以增加编程课程的实践性,提供编程实践项目和实践机会,让学生将所学知识应用到实际问题中。

    总之,学校推动学生学习编程是为了培养学生的创造力、解决问题的能力和数字化时代所需的技能。尽管学校可能面临一些困难和挑战,但通过合理的措施和方法,可以促进学生学习编程的发展。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部